​An Exceptional Georgian Walnut & Mahogany Bachelor's Chest of Drawers

​Circa 1760

​Rarely does a piece of this extraordinary caliber and untouched elegance come to the open market. This magnificent Georgian bachelor’s chest represents the absolute pinnacle of 18th-century cabinetmaking, boasting some of the finest, most dramatic cuts of book-matched timber imaginable. It is an investment-grade statement piece designed for the discerning collector.

​Timber & Craftsmanship

​The chest is a masterclass in contrasting tones and textures. The top features a breathtaking expanse of deeply figured, vibrant mahogany, framed by an exquisite, wide cross-banding of select walnut.

​The striking grain continues seamlessly across the drawer fronts, showcasing a rich, warm patina and a complex, highly decorative feathering that catches the light beautifully.

​Fine Details & Configuration

​Drawer Arrangement: A classic, highly functional configuration of two short over three long graduated drawers.

​Hardware: The drawers are elegantly dressed with their original, exceptionally cast solid brass swan-neck handles and refined oval escutcheons.

​The Brush Slide: Essential to the classic "bachelor's" design, a smooth pull-out brushing slide lined in a dark insert sits neatly beneath the top moulding, offering an elegant extra surface.

​The Base: The chest stands proudly on beautifully shaped, substantial ogee bracket feet—a costly, sophisticated feature reserved only for furniture of the highest status and quality during the Georgian era.

​Condition & Security: The oak-lined drawer linings are wonderfully clean, smooth-running, and demonstrate tight, expert dovetail joints. Remarkably, the chest is accompanied by its original working key.

​Dimensions

​Width: 77.5 cm (30.5")

​Depth: 51 cm (20")

​Height: 82 cm (32.3")

Originating in the 18th century during the Georgian era, a bachelors chest is a small, compact chest of drawers specifically fitted with a pull-out brushing slide designed to assist with folding and maintaining clothing.

Georgian cabinetmakers predominantly used fine walnut or mahogany for exterior surfaces, often decorated with figured veneers, supported by secondary woods like pine or oak for drawer linings, and fitted with cast brass drop handles.

Authentic period pieces display evidence of hand construction, including hand-cut dovetail joints, oak or pine drawer linings with grain running front-to-back, period-appropriate brass escutcheons, and natural age-related timber shrinkage.

A Georgian chest functions effectively as a focal piece in a modern hallway, living room alcove, or bedroom, especially when paired with modern art, contemporary table lamps, or minimal ceramic accessories.

Maintain the timber finish by dusting regularly with a microfibre cloth and applying high-grade beeswax once or twice a year, ensuring the piece is positioned away from direct sunlight and artificial heat sources.
